Hex timber screws are specialized fasteners designed for use in timber and wood construction. These screws feature a hexagonal head and are engineered to provide high pull-out resistance and shear strength in wood materials. The unique design of hex timber screws allows for efficient and secure installation, making them suitable for structural and load-bearing applications in timber framing, landscaping, and outdoor construction projects.

Stainless steel threaded rods, also known as threaded bars, are versatile fasteners commonly used in construction, manufacturing, and engineering applications. These rods feature continuous threading along their entire length and are made from stainless steel, offering corrosion resistance and durability. Stainless steel threaded rods are available in various diameters and lengths, providing a reliable means of attachment, support, and reinforcement in a wide range of projects.
